Major global manufacturers of Graphene Film Heat Sink include Baknor, MINORU, Changzhou Fuxi Technology, Btr New Material Group, Daoming Optics & Chemical, Guangdong Morui Technology, Shenzhen Xidao Technology, etc. In 2025, the world's top three vendors accounted for approximately % of revenue.
